How is it that every Advocate-area football team — or at least the five teams that are playing this week — is on the road Friday night?
To follow a local team this week, you’ll have to hit the road to Albany, Irvine, Lawrenceburg, Mount Vernon or Somerset. I love a good road trip more than most, but it’s a pretty rare thing not to find at least one of our teams at home in a given week, though it has happened before.
Not all road games are created equal, of course, but at least three of the five on this week’s schedule will be stern tests for the visiting teams: Danville at Somerset, Mercer County at Anderson County and Lincoln County at Rockcastle County.
The lone local team that isn’t traveling tonight is Boyle County, which is off. The Rebels can rest on the laurels of their three straight impressive wins for one more week before making the short trip to Mercer on Sept. 18.
